| /* SPDX-License-Identifier: GPL-2.0-only */
 | |
| /*
 | |
|  * leds-regulator.h - platform data structure for regulator driven LEDs.
 | |
|  *
 | |
|  * Copyright (C) 2009 Antonio Ospite <ospite@studenti.unina.it>
 | |
|  */
 | |
| 
 | |
| #ifndef __LINUX_LEDS_REGULATOR_H
 | |
| #define __LINUX_LEDS_REGULATOR_H
 | |
| 
 | |
| /*
 | |
|  * Use "vled" as supply id when declaring the regulator consumer:
 | |
|  *
 | |
|  * static struct regulator_consumer_supply pcap_regulator_VVIB_consumers [] = {
 | |
|  * 	{ .dev_name = "leds-regulator.0", .supply = "vled" },
 | |
|  * };
 | |
|  *
 | |
|  * If you have several regulator driven LEDs, you can append a numerical id to
 | |
|  * .dev_name as done above, and use the same id when declaring the platform
 | |
|  * device:
 | |
|  *
 | |
|  * static struct led_regulator_platform_data a780_vibrator_data = {
 | |
|  * 	.name   = "a780::vibrator",
 | |
|  * };
 | |
|  *
 | |
|  * static struct platform_device a780_vibrator = {
 | |
|  * 	.name = "leds-regulator",
 | |
|  * 	.id   = 0,
 | |
|  * 	.dev  = {
 | |
|  * 		.platform_data = &a780_vibrator_data,
 | |
|  * 	},
 | |
|  * };
 | |
|  */
 | |
| 
 | |
| #include <linux/leds.h>
 | |
| 
 | |
| struct led_regulator_platform_data {
 | |
| 	char *name;                     /* LED name as expected by LED class */
 | |
| 	enum led_brightness brightness; /* initial brightness value */
 | |
| };
 | |
| 
 | |
| #endif /* __LINUX_LEDS_REGULATOR_H */
